This 90-minute session offered a unique opportunity to hear directly from Seher Pahade, a trailblazing 13-year-old teenager who is an inspiration for change. She is an embodiment of a compassionate and driven individual committed to forging a brighter future. Seher's heart resonates with the cause of child rights, fueled by her personal experience as a victim of bullying. This adversity transformed her into a resilient advocate, refusing to be a bystander and instead emerging as an upstander in situations that challenge even adults. Please listen as we engage the voice of youth by understanding methods, strategies and interventions to prevent all forms of bullying. Learn ways to create a safe physical, emotional and psychological space for children from the perspective of a young survivor. Having battled through toxic peers and bullies herself, Seher will be able to provide a clear understanding of how it really affects the victim. She will also be able to provide personal insight on how adult leaders can protect a child from experiencing bullying. Children look up to professionals from all fields of practice, parents, teachers, community leaders, doctors and important stakeholders in every aspect of their lives and it is our responsibility to protect children from bullying and its lasting effects.
